I just bought eso for xboxone, GT: The StewPidazzo its pretty fun. I am only lvl 7 because I have spent so much time stealing stuff and farming chests, wood and iron. I can honestly say it is way better than I expected. It will hold me over until fallout 4. The nicest part is you can spend real $$ for stuff but its only cosmetic stuff so it isnt really pay 2 win which makes it fair. I rolled a dragonknight and i can tank/dps/heal. The talent trees and skills seem pretty indepth as I amsomewhat lost but it is definately worth the $60 price.

Plus the subscription fee? That's what made me not want it
No subscription fee bro it is not required. I did not get the monthly subscription thing. With $14.99 monthly thing you get double exp, 1,500 crowns a month, free dlc and a ring that grants friends partied with you double exp also. So you can just buy the game and play for free (which is what I am doing) or you can do the monthly plus thing or you can buy a starter pack that gives you a mount some potions crafting materials and double exp scroll. I am anti pay to win and they have done a good job on keeping it fair.
